main thoughts

This was an interesting, somewhat unique read that I didn’t see coming. The first…maybe half?…of the book was a solid 3-stars. I definitely enjoyed the premise and it had me questioning what was going to happen next. The first MMC we encounter is insufferable. He treats the FMC so terribly that I almost couldn’t stand reading him. He’s also terribly racist toward humans, so he pretty much only refers to the FMC by derogatory names and that was hard to read. I’m not sure why this MMC was so much more difficult for me to read than other dark romance MMCs, but this one just hit me hard for some reason. So if you think you may be sensitive to anything in this book, please make sure to check trigger warnings before reading this book.

The other MMCs are incredibly intriguing to me and I’m looking forward to learning more about them in the next book(s?).

And aside from struggling with Sebastien’s character, I loved this book. The world was fascinating, our FMC was vulnerable but sassy, and the sci-fi twist was fantastic. I honestly can’t wait to read book 2; there are so many questions I have that I’m hoping will be answered in the next book.

Also, I have to say that I greatly enjoyed the author’s writing style. She had some beautiful quotes that I loved and I’m looking forward to reading more from her.

final thoughts

While the first half of this book was a little difficult to get through, the last half made it all worth it. And now that I’ve finished book 1, I’m going to be anxiously awaiting book 2! I would definitely recommend this book for fans of dark fantasy romance with a splash of sci-fi thrown in.
